Jamalpur: A court here today sentenced a man to five years of imprisonment in a case lodged over the attempted rape of a schoolgirl in 2020. Judge of Women and Children Repression Prevention Tribunal-1, Muhammad Abdur Rahim, pronounced the judgment.
According to Bangladesh Sangbad Sangstha, the court also fined the convict Taka 20,000 to pay the victim. The convicted person was identified as Md Kholilur Rahman, 25, son of Md Babul Miah from Jhalur Char Modhyapara village in Dewanganj upazila of the district.
In brief, the prosecution story states that on March 30, 2020, Kholilur Rahman lured a neighboring girl, a student of class 10, into his room and attempted to rape her. However, the girl managed to escape from the scene.
Following the incident, the victim’s father filed a case with Dewanganj Model Police Station against Kholilur. After examining eight prosecution witnesses and relevant documents, the judge found him guilty and handed down the verdict.
